菜单 学习猿地 - LMONKEY

VIP

开通学习猿地VIP

尊享10项VIP特权 持续新增

知识通关挑战

打卡带练!告别无效练习

接私单赚外块

VIP优先接,累计金额超百万

学习猿地私房课免费学

大厂实战课仅对VIP开放

你的一对一导师

每月可免费咨询大牛30次

领取更多软件工程师实用特权

入驻
2458
4

python 用 jieba 给一句话分词

原创
05/13 14:22
阅读数 3317

场景

有这样一个场景。你得到一个归属地,归属地包含省市地区,并且这个归属地信息是连续在一起的。当你想分别得到省,市,地区呢。人工,头脑分析,熟悉的地方,你估计可以分开。但在代码的世界里,怎么分开呢。在 python 中有个很好用的库,jiaba。结巴啊。

例子

“工信处女干事每月经过下属科室都要亲口交代24口交换机等技术性器件的安装工作” 分开一个一个的词组。

seg_list = jieba.cut("工信处女干事每月经过下属科室都要亲口交代24口
             交换机等技术性器件的安装工作", cut_all=False)
print("Default Mode: " + " - ".join(seg_list))

输出:

Default Mode: 工信处 - 女干事 - 每月 - 经过 - 下属 - 科室 - 
              都 - 要 - 亲口 - 交代 - 24 - 口 - 交换机 - 等 -
              技术性 - 器件 - 的 - 安装 - 工作

最后

这里只是举例 phthon 利用 jiaba 分词,能很好的将一句话分隔成所盼望的词语。具体实现,还得自己动手。

发表评论

0/200
2458 点赞
4 评论
收藏
为你推荐 换一批